STSrid (geometry Data Type)

[!INCLUDE SQL Server Azure SQL Database Azure SQL Managed Instance]

STSrid is an integer representing the spatial reference identifier of the instance.

This property can be modified.

Syntax

  
STSrid  

Return Types

[!INCLUDEssNoVersion] type: int

CLR type: SqlInt32

Examples

The first example creates a geometry instance with the SRID value 13 and uses STSrid to confirm the SRID.

DECLARE @g geometry;  
SET @g = geometry::STGeomFromText('POLYGON((0 0, 3 0, 3 3, 0 3, 0 0))', 13);  
SELECT @g.STSrid;  

The second example uses STSrid to change the SRID value of the instance to 23 and then confirms the modified SRID value.

SET @g.STSrid = 23;  
SELECT @g.STSrid;
